What Exactly Is a Non Sticky Bonus Casino UK Offer?

A non sticky bonus, sometimes called a “non-sticky” or “separate balance” promotion, is a deposit match where the bonus funds are credited to a distinct balance from your cash deposit. The critical feature is that your original deposit is always withdrawable immediately — you never have to wager your own money to release it. If you deposit £50 and receive a £50 non sticky bonus, you can request a withdrawal of that £50 deposit right away, even if the bonus is still sitting in your account untouched. The bonus funds remain available for wagering, but they cannot be withdrawn until the playthrough requirement is met. This structure suits players who want the safety net of their cash being accessible while still enjoying the extra playing power from the bonus. It is the polar structural opposite of a sticky bonus, where deposit and bonus are merged into one pot that must be wagered together before any withdrawal is possible.

For UK players, every such promotion on a trusted picks list will operate under the same core principle: your money stays yours. The practical effect is that you can test an operator’s game selection, speed of payouts, and overall feel without gambling your entire bankroll against a wagering wall. If you hit a lucky streak early and want to lock in profits from your own stake, you can. The bonus continues to work in the background, and any winnings from it are subject to the stated wagering terms. This is a structural advantage that experienced players value highly, especially when exploring a new site for the first time.

Selection Criteria: How to Choose a Non Sticky Bonus Casino UK

Not all non sticky bonuses are created equal. The key differentiators lie in the fine print. Here are the factors that separate a genuinely valuable offer from a marketing gimmick.

Wagering Multiplier and Contribution Rates

The wagering multiplier applied to the bonus is the most important number. Look for multipliers between 20x and 45x on the bonus amount. Anything above 50x becomes difficult to clear profitably, especially on slots with typical RTPs. Equally critical is the contribution of different game types toward wagering. Slots almost always count 100%, but table games like blackjack or roulette might contribute only 10% or even zero. If you prefer table games, a non sticky promotion casino UK trusted picks list should explicitly state high contribution percentages for your chosen games.

Maximum Bet Limits During Wagering

Most non sticky bonuses cap your maximum bet while wagering, often at £5 or £10 per spin. Exceeding this limit can void the bonus and any winnings. This is standard practice to prevent high-rollers from clearing playthrough too quickly, but it also affects your strategy. A £5 max bet means you will need more spins to clear a £2,000 wagering requirement, which increases the house edge exposure over time. Check this limit before committing.

Game Eligibility and Exclusion Lists

Operators often exclude certain high-RTP slots or progressive jackpots from contributing to wagering. Some also restrict bonus use to specific game categories. A transparent operator lists eligible games clearly in the terms. If the list is vague or buried, consider it a red flag.

Withdrawal Speed and Limits

The whole point of a non sticky bonus is maintaining access to your cash. That cash is only useful if you can withdraw it quickly when you choose to. Look for operators with a proven reputation for fast withdrawals — ideally within 24 hours for e-wallets and up to three days for debit cards. Some operators also impose minimum withdrawal amounts that could frustrate smaller cash-outs.

Time Limits on Bonus Clearance

Bonuses typically expire after a set period, commonly 7 to 30 days from activation. A shorter window increases pressure to play through the wagering requirement, which can lead to riskier bets. For casual players, a 30-day window is preferable.

Pitfalls to Avoid with Non Sticky Bonuses

Even with a well-structured non sticky bonus, certain traps can reduce your effective value. The most common pitfall is misunderstanding the contribution of different games. You might play a slot that contributes 100%, but if you switch to a table game that contributes only 10%, the wagering requirement becomes effectively ten times harder to clear. Always check the game contribution table in the terms before playing.

Another issue is the maximum bet limit. If you accidentally place a bet above the stated cap — say £11 on a £10 max — the operator may void the bonus and confiscate winnings. This is strictly enforced by most UKGC-licensed operators. Set a bet limit in your account settings to avoid this mistake.

Time pressure can also lead to poor decisions. If the bonus expires in 7 days and you have only cleared 30% of the wagering, you may be tempted to chase the requirement with larger bets, increasing risk. Plan your play sessions early. For smaller bonuses, it is often better to clear the wagering in one or two focused sessions rather than spreading it out.

Finally, be aware that some operators restrict bonus use to specific “bonus eligible” slots. These slots may have lower RTPs than the site average. If the eligible list is limited, consider whether the bonus is worth the reduced return. A non sticky bonus casino UK offer with a generous multiplier but a poor game selection may still be a bad deal.

Before You Claim: Three Reader Questions

Can I withdraw my deposit immediately after claiming a non sticky bonus?

Yes, that is the defining feature. Your cash balance is separate from the bonus balance, and you can request a withdrawal of your deposit at any time after it is credited. The bonus balance remains active and must be wagered according to the terms before any winnings from it become withdrawable. Some operators may impose a short holding period on first deposits for security checks, but that applies to all deposits, not just bonus ones.

Is it possible to lose the bonus if I withdraw my deposit early?

No, withdrawing your deposit does not forfeit the bonus. The bonus continues to sit in your account and can be used for wagering as normal. However, if you withdraw your deposit and then later request a withdrawal of the bonus winnings, you must have met the full wagering requirement on the bonus. The bonus itself is not cancelled by a cash withdrawal, but any remaining wagering requirement still applies.

What happens if I don’t meet the wagering requirement before the bonus expires?

If the time limit expires before you have completed the playthrough, the bonus balance and any winnings from it are forfeited and removed from your account. Your cash balance — including your original deposit — remains unaffected and withdrawable. This is why it is important to check the expiry window before claiming. Most operators display a countdown in the bonus section of your account, so set a reminder if you are a casual player.
